A Surrey Police detention officer who pleaded guilty to assaulting a woman who was being detained in custody at the time has been dismissed from the Force.
Joanne Vickery, 47, was dismissed from the Force without notice following a gross misconduct hearing held at Surrey Police Headquarters last month, where she was found to have breached the policing standards of professional behaviour about use of force, discreditable conduct, honesty and integrity and duties and responsibilities.
